Transaction 580c76ea319f8423322c1eb7fe6c41bad19c6d9ac20c9a96da5a37984322230f
1 Input
1 Output
-
580c76ea319f8423322c1eb7fe6c41bad19c6d9ac20c9a96da5a37984322230f:0
- value
- 524994709
- script pubkey
- OP_0 OP_PUSHBYTES_20 0112fa0ae587eb4b71600280d85c823ab4087c3b
- address
- bc1qqyf05zh9sl45kutqq2qdshyz826qslpmjganz5